add recoveres groups app

pull/1/head
serkus01 3 years ago
parent 281ffe466a
commit 0299af4b02

@ -8,16 +8,21 @@ def ScanRecoverFile():
if os.path.exists('./recovers.txt'): if os.path.exists('./recovers.txt'):
with open('./recovers.txt') as f: with open('./recovers.txt') as f:
ScanResult =f.read().split("\n") ScanResult =f.read().split("\n")
else: else:
print("Файла со список рекомедации нейдлено") print("Файла со список рекомедации нейдлено")
res = GenRecoversFun(ScanResult) res = GenRecoversFun(ScanResult)
return res return res
def GenRecoversFun(Reclist): def GenRecoversFun(Reclist):
result =[] result ={}
cat= ""
for r in Reclist: for r in Reclist:
result.append(search(r)) if r.startswith("["):
cat = r.replace("[", "") and r.replace("]", "")
result[r.replace("[", "") and r.replace("]", "")]= []
else:
result[cat].append(search(r))
return result return result

@ -46,8 +46,8 @@ def create_db():
if not pkg_name[:-1] in all_pkgs: if not pkg_name[:-1] in all_pkgs:
#print(str(d.split("/")[-2] +"/" + d.split("/")[-1] +"\n")) #print(str(d.split("/")[-2] +"/" + d.split("/")[-1] +"\n"))
if pkg_name[:-1] in AliaseCategory: if str(d.split("/")[-2] +"/" + d.split("/")[-1]) in AliaseCategory:
all_pkgs.append(AliaseCategory[pkg_name[:-1]]) all_pkgs.append(AliaseCategory[d])
else: else:
all_pkgs.append(str(d.split("/")[-2] +"/" + d.split("/")[-1])) all_pkgs.append(str(d.split("/")[-2] +"/" + d.split("/")[-1]))

@ -1,25 +1,42 @@
[net-im]
net-im/element-desktop-bin element-desktop-bin
net-im/telegram-desktop-bin telegram-desktop-bin
zoom
pidgin
teams
slack
[Музыка]
audacity audacity
clementine
mixx
lmms
mpd
[Видео]
obs-studio obs-studio
kdenlive kdenlive
mixxx
mplayer mplayer
vlc vlc
mplayer
[Web-Серверв]
nginx nginx
www-servers/apache apache
yaws [dev-util]
dev-util/pycharm-community pycharm-community
[Графика]
gimp gimp
blender blender
[Игры]
steam-launcher steam-launcher
[Браузеры]
firefox-bin firefox-bin
chromium
falkpon
links
vivaldi
netsurf
[app-utils]
vim vim
nano nano
vscode
jedit
gedit
Loading…
Cancel
Save